Sudan's capital swarmed by tens of thousands marking anniversary of 2019 'massacre'


Tens of thousands of protesters swarmed the streets of Sudan's capital, Khartoum, on Friday to mark the third anniversary of the violent break-up of a sit-in protest outside the army headquarters, witnesses said. AFPThe protesters demand an end to military rule and a return to the civilian-led democratic transition upended by the coup. The witnesses said concrete barriers and barbed wire were placed around the military headquarters near the capital’s city centre. Roads leading to the army headquarters and the nearby Nile-side Republican palace were sealed off, they said.
